Transaction f44ae86f59459f151713acc7c01c7e30be36a7a7ab19360ee396ad42a9be4139

1 Input
2 Outputs
  • f44ae86f59459f151713acc7c01c7e30be36a7a7ab19360ee396ad42a9be4139:0
  • value  10868210
    address  1HDQ6HNHdsknH3LFQy5GEe1ud534Eoek8Z
  • f44ae86f59459f151713acc7c01c7e30be36a7a7ab19360ee396ad42a9be4139:1
  • value  4234325458
    address  17TDgHtM7WuZN1qztwqUf7uwChyqCzGXZL